The Raising of Lazarus. 1780. Oil on canvas. 101 x 130 ins (256.5 x 330.2 cms). Wadsworth Atheneum Museum of Art. It was commissioned as the altarpiece for Winchester Cathedral, Hampshire, England, where it remained 1782-1900; purchased by J. Pierpont Morgan, New York City, in 1900.
